@charset "UTF-8";

@media screen and (min-width: 769px) {
a[href^="tel"] {
    pointer-events: none;
}
}
@media screen and (max-width: 768px) {
#contact_btn + .contents_btn01 .content_wrapper {
    display: flex;
    flex-direction: column;
    justify-content: center;
    align-items: center;
}
#contact_btn + .contents_btn01 .content_wrapper a {
    max-width: 240px;
}
}

/*-------------------------*/

.contents_btn01 a[target=_blank] span:before {
  right: 10px;
}

.contents_btn01 a[target=_blank] span:after {
  right: 12px;
}